Huadian Heavy Industries Co (601226)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 23.5% as of June 2023. Strategic assets (PP&E of CN¥1.04 Billion plus long-term investments of CN¥-) total CN¥1.04 Billion, measured against net assets of CN¥4.44 Billion.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base.

Annual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Huadian Heavy Industries Co (2011–2022)

The table below presents the year-by-year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Huadian Heavy Industries Co from 2011 to 2022, covering 12 annual filings. Each row shows PP&E, long-term investments, strategic assets combined, net assets, the index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year SAAI Strategic Assets (CNY) PP&E LT Investments Net Assets Change (pp)
2022 26.4% CN¥1.16 Billion CN¥1.16 Billion CN¥- CN¥4.38 Billion ▼ -7.7 pp
2021 34.1% CN¥1.37 Billion CN¥1.37 Billion CN¥- CN¥4.02 Billion ▲ +12.2 pp
2020 21.9% CN¥817.14 Million CN¥817.14 Million CN¥- CN¥3.73 Billion ▼ -1.5 pp
2019 23.5% CN¥857.24 Million CN¥857.24 Million CN¥- CN¥3.65 Billion ▼ -1.7 pp
2018 25.2% CN¥903.53 Million CN¥903.53 Million CN¥- CN¥3.59 Billion ▼ -1.7 pp
2017 26.9% CN¥951.30 Million CN¥951.30 Million CN¥- CN¥3.54 Billion ▼ -1.7 pp
2016 28.5% CN¥999.76 Million CN¥999.76 Million CN¥- CN¥3.50 Billion ▲ +0.0 pp
2015 28.5% CN¥1.06 Billion CN¥1.06 Billion CN¥- CN¥3.71 Billion ▼ -2.2 pp
2014 30.8% CN¥1.10 Billion CN¥1.10 Billion CN¥- CN¥3.56 Billion ▼ -27.4 pp
2013 58.1% CN¥1.02 Billion CN¥1.02 Billion CN¥- CN¥1.75 Billion ▼ -6.3 pp
2012 64.4% CN¥895.96 Million CN¥895.96 Million CN¥- CN¥1.39 Billion ▲ +14.1 pp
2011 50.4% CN¥555.88 Million CN¥555.88 Million CN¥- CN¥1.10 Billion
pp = percentage points
